About propan-2-yl 7-(4-fluorophenyl)-2-methyl-4-(4-methylsulfanylphenyl)-5-oxo-4,6,7,8-tetrahydro-1H-quinoline-3-carboxylate

propan-2-yl 7-(4-fluorophenyl)-2-methyl-4-(4-methylsulfanylphenyl)-5-oxo-4,6,7,8-tetrahydro-1H-quinoline-3-carboxylate (PubChem CID 2949072) has the molecular formula C27H28FNO3S and a molecular weight of 465.59 g/mol. Its IUPAC name is propan-2-yl 7-(4-fluorophenyl)-2-methyl-4-(4-methylsulfanylphenyl)-5-oxo-4,6,7,8-tetrahydro-1H-quinoline-3-carboxylate.
